Originally issued in 1984, Peek-A-Boo Riddim was produced by Roy Cousins for an unknown label and comes through as a tight little roots-era showcase anchored by Earl Sixteen’s Peek-A-Boo. The set is notably minimal, with just two tracks and a single featured artist, which gives the riddim a focused, stripped-back feel rather than a crowded showcase format. Roy Cousins was already an established figure in reggae production by this point, and this release sits neatly in the 1960s-to-80s archive alongside his other work from the era.
